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United KingdomOur dislike is an ongoing issue in all hotels - SMOKING. No one should be allowed to smoke on the balconies, on the terraces by the bars and not around the pool. Our balcony became a no zone area for us because the person was smoking in the room next door. We had to go jn and shut our balcony door. The people who sit on the terraces smoking - the smoke rises and goes straight into the rooms. We like to sit on the balcony at night after dinner but the smoke smell meant we had to go into our room and close the door. A single smoking zone should be mandatory outside the front of the hotel rather than on the balconies and terraces. It really is that simple to solve this dreadful problem.
Breakfast times were good and there was plenty of choice for my husband. I took my own gluten free bread but there was no separate toaster which for people who are cealiac is a big issue because of cross contamination. Hotel is lovely and clean, staff are friendly and were patient with me as I practiced speaking spanish. Our sevond stay and we will be back.

SpainGot a single bed, which I don't like. The rooms and corridors feel really dated. The gym needed a bit of attention. The juice and coffee at breakfast were garbage.
The breakfast was really good on the whole, with loads of fruit and plenty of options, even full English - plus there was some variety each day. There's a lot of free street parking round abouts. It's 2 mins to the sea. The gardens are pretty and the pool looked good, if it wasn't December. The free WIFI was super fast - 50 or 60Mb/s.
